Smart Home Automation—Use Cases of a Secure and Integrated Voice-Control System
Smart home automation is expected to improve living standards with the evolution of internet of things (IoT) that facilitate the remote control of residential appliances. There are, however, several factors that require attention for broader successful consumer adoption. This paper focusses on three...
